    Grange Lane Dualisation Project 60% Complete, Says Prime Minister

    Work on the Grange Lane dualisation undertaking in St. Catherine has reached 60% completion, in response to Prime Minister Andrew Holness. Talking in Parliament on Tuesday, January 21, the Prime Minister supplied updates on the Authorities’s Particular Capital Expenditure (CAPEX) Programme, aimed toward reworking city infrastructure throughout Jamaica.

    Upcoming Initiatives in Focus

    Prime Minister Holness introduced that when Grange Lane is accomplished, the main focus will shift to the Braeton Street and Hellshire Essential Street dualisation initiatives. These are scheduled to start within the fourth quarter of the 2024/25 fiscal yr.

    Launched as a part of a broader city transportation initiative, the CAPEX Programme targets visitors alleviation and improved street capability. Key initiatives below the programme embody:

    • Grange Lane dualisation
    • Braeton and Hellshire Essential Street upgrades
    • East Kings Home Street/Girl Musgrave Street enhancements
    • Arthur Wint Drive growth
    • New Portmore entry street from Mandela Freeway
    • Sandy Gully Bridge widening

    Advantages for City Centres

    The initiative is anticipated to profit round 1.2 million Jamaicans in Kingston, St. Andrew, and St. Catherine. It consists of complete upgrades corresponding to street widening, enhanced drainage, water and sewerage techniques, visitors administration, security measures, and future-ready broadband infrastructure.

    Holness emphasised the significance of streetscaping in these initiatives, together with planting timber and including greenery for beautification and warmth management. “After we construct our new roads, we don’t at all times deal with the smooth infrastructure. With these roads, particularly in Kingston, we’re integrating streetscaping to create a extra interesting and sustainable surroundings,” he mentioned.

    Arthur Wint Drive Growth and Different Initiatives

    The Arthur Wint Drive undertaking has been expanded to incorporate a stretch from Arthur Wint Drive via Tom Redcam Drive to Camp Street. It would function new sewerage techniques and waterlines, considerably benefiting native residents, companies, and builders. Work on this undertaking is anticipated to start within the subsequent fiscal yr.

    Moreover, initiatives just like the Sandy Gully Bridge upgrades and the New Portmore Entrance growth are present process funding value determinations.

    Balancing Progress with Minimal Disruption

    Acknowledging issues in regards to the simultaneous graduation of a number of large-scale initiatives, Holness assured Jamaicans that each effort will likely be made to reduce disruptions.

    “The Particular CAPEX Programme demonstrates the Authorities’s dedication to modernising infrastructure, driving future growth, and enhancing high quality of life for all Jamaicans,” he said.

    Portmore’s Strategic Function

    Three of the six CAPEX initiatives are centered in Portmore, in recognition of its transition to parish standing and anticipated future growth.

    Holness reaffirmed the Authorities’s dedication to assembly the calls for of a rising and fashionable Jamaica, guaranteeing that infrastructure retains tempo with the nation’s progress.
